What is the Claude Text Editor MCP Server?
This is a text editing system based on the Model Context Protocol (MCP) that allows users to directly send text to Claude for editing via the right - click menu on macOS. After editing, the result will be automatically returned and copied to the clipboard.How to use the Claude Text Editor MCP Server?
After installation, simply select the text, right - click on 'Edit with Claude', and the text will be sent to Claude for processing. After editing, the result will be automatically saved and copied to the clipboard.Use cases
Suitable for users who need to quickly edit text, proofread content, or generate more professional text. Applicable to scenarios such as writing, programming, and translation.Main features
Zero - friction editing
Just right - click on the text to send it to Claude for editing without switching windows or waiting for timeouts.
File processing
Supports direct file processing without worrying about time limits or focus switching.
Automatic queue management
Files can be put into the inbox, and the system will automatically process and save them to the outbox.
Custom prompts
Edit instructions can be customized through the `claude_prompt.txt` file.
Cross - application compatibility
Can be used in any macOS application to achieve system - level text editing.
Desktop notifications
Desktop notifications will be received after editing is completed to ensure timely access to results.
Automatic clipboard
The edited text will be automatically copied to the clipboard for immediate use.
MCP integration
Natively integrated with Claude Desktop, providing a stable and efficient text editing experience.

How to use
Install the software
Clone the project from GitHub and run the installation script for installation.
Initialize Claude
Create a new chat in Claude Desktop and paste the initialization code.
Use shortcuts
Press the ⌥⌘. key after selecting the text, or use the `ce` command to edit the clipboard content.
View results
After editing, the result will be automatically saved to `~/.claude_text_editor/outbox/` and copied to the clipboard.
